But the move is being described as “political grandstanding” by another councillor.
Crs Aaron Keown and Sam MacDonald want the Christchurch City Council to immediately suspend consultation on a portion of the controversial Wheels to Wings cycleway on Harewood Rd, west of Greers Rd.
They want staff to work with the Fendalton-Waimairi-Harewood Community Board and the community to start a fresh process and develop a new design the public can take ownership of. The council will vote on the proposal on Thursday. Read more here.

The 36-year-old first took part in the event in 2019 with her golden retriever Minnie, and improved on her time the following year despite enduring long-standing struggles with liver and bowel disease.
This year she comes prepared with a game plan and a goal – to once again beat her previous time in the 10-kilometre walk and run though the Port Hills on February 21, created to honour the lives lost in the Canterbury earthquakes.
